It’s National Dessert Day! 🧁

Did you know that baking isn’t just delicious—it can actually help reduce cravings and support recovery? šŸ„„āœØ

When you engage in baking, you’re:

Activating the brain’s reward system in a positive way, creating healthy, satisfying experiences.

Reducing stress and cravings by focusing your mind and body on a creative, tactile activity.

Building positive neural pathways, helping your brain form new habits that replace old, unhealthy patterns.

Whether it’s kneading dough, decorating cupcakes, or mixing ingredients for a fresh loaf of bread, baking can be a powerful tool for your recovery journey.

šŸ’” Tip: Make it mindful! Focus on the textures, smells, and process—not just the end result.

šŸ§ šŸ’™ Mental Health: The Foundation of Well-Being

Your mental health isn't just about feeling happy—it's about how you think, feel, and act in every part of your life. It influences your relationships, work, and even your physical health. 🌱

Why It Matters:

Emotional Resilience: Good mental health helps you cope with stress and bounce back from challenges.

Stronger Relationships: A positive mindset fosters empathy, trust, and connection with others.

Increased Productivity: Mental well-being enhances focus, decision-making, and performance.

Better Physical Health: Mental health impacts sleep, immune function, and overall vitality.

Protecting Your Mental Health:

Recognize the Signs: Early awareness of mental distress can lead to timely support.

Seek Support: Talking to a therapist or counselor can provide valuable guidance.

Practice Self-Care: Regular sleep, exercise, and mindfulness activities promote mental well-being.

Remember, taking care of your mind is just as important as taking care of your body. Let's prioritize mental health together! šŸ’ŖšŸ§˜ā€ā™€ļø

Every Saturday at 10:00 a.m. MST, our AspenRidge alumni host a virtual Recovery Dharma meeting. Recovery Dharma is a peer-led community that uses Buddhist practices, like meditation, self-inquiry, and compassion, as tools for healing from addiction.

Fall blues getting you down? Seasonal depression is something many of us face—but there are ways to ease the burden.

Here are some helpful tips:

Stay active with light exercise like walking.

Get outside and soak up some daylight.

Keep a regular routine with sleep, meals, and activity.

Stay connected with others—support makes a difference.

Practice self-care through journaling, mindfulness, or hobbies you enjoy.

You don’t have to go through this alone.

If you tend to get the ā€˜winter blues,’ you may have seasonal affective disorder (SAD). Therapy, medication, and light boxes could bring relief.
